Avondale Heights (3034) sits close to the Maribyrnong River corridor and includes a mix of older brick veneer homes, weatherboard sections, and renovated properties with added rooms or reconfigured layouts. In this area, it’s common to see past maintenance shortcuts, subfloor moisture issues, and older materials that may include asbestos-containing products in eaves, wet areas or external cladding. A targeted inspection helps you separate cosmetic updates from underlying defects.

We inspect accessible areas for termite activity, timber pest damage, and conditions that increase risk, including moisture and timber-to-ground contact. Established gardens, older fences, and subfloor zones around Avondale Heights properties can create favourable conditions, so we check likely entry points and vulnerable timbers.
